Here are the most common causes of P0455. If these vapors leak from the system, you’ll often smell them faintly while operating the vehicle. The EVAP system deals directly with fuel vapors. You should particularly notice the smell of fuel around the fuel tank area or fuel filler tube. P0455 code will typically not be accompanied by any noticeable symptoms other than the smell of gas and the service engine soon light. The “large” really refers to how much pressure is lost. While the trouble code may state that there is a “large leak” in the EVAP system of your Saturn Vue, the actual leak will most likely still look relatively small. For example, P0456 means your Vue has a small EVAP leak. P0455 indicates a large leak in the evaporative emission control system. When there is a large leak in the Saturn Vue’s EVAP system, it will throw the P0455 OBDII Code. The EVAP system prevents harmful gases from escaping into the atmosphere and does not affect how the engine runs, which means this code is not a breakdown risk. Your Vue’s EVAP system (Evaporative Emission Control System) helps reduce emissions from your vehicle by collecting fuel vapors from the gas tank and sending them back into the engine for combustion. If the pick up pads are not positioned correctly to the underbody pick up areas, this type of damage may occur. To avoid this situation, particularly when using the type of hoist where the arms swing in and the pick up pads swivel, be sure of the placement of the pick up pads. Incorrect placement of the hoist pads may cause a crack/leak in the EVAP canister plastic and eventually set one or both of the following DTCs: Please discard Corporate Bulletin Number 05-06-04-004D (Section 06 - Engine).Ī review of warranty repair orders and parts returned to GM for analysis suggests that EVAP canisters are being damaged when the vehicle is being put up on a hoist for service.
